. The ratio of three angles of a triangle is 1:2:3. Find the measurement of<br>the angles.​
nydimaria [60]

Answer:

Step-by-step explanation:

Sum of angles in a Δ= 180°

x + 2x +3x = 180

6x= 180

Divide both sides by 6

x=30

sooo x= 1×30= 30,   2x= 2×30= 60,   3x=3×30= 90

since 30+60+90= 180

∴the angles are 30°,60° and 90° respectively

Suppose that you want to design a cylinder with the same volume as a given cylinder but you want to use a diff radius and height
Anton [14]

Answer:

Yes, r and h can be changed to produce same volume by;

Increasing "r" and decreasing "h" or by decreasing "r" and increasing "h".

Step-by-step explanation:

What the question is simply asking is if we can get same volume of a particular cylinder if we change the radius and height.

Now, volume of a cylinder is;

V = πr²h

Now, for the volume to remain the same, if we increase "r", it means we have to decrease "h", likewise, if we decrease "r", we now have to increase "h".
